Twenty seven years of laying stone in this county
My father started the business in 1998 doing driveways and paver work, and I took it over in 2016 after ten years of laying stone alongside him. We narrowed it down to hardscape because that is the part we are good at, and because the yards where something goes wrong three years later are almost always the ones where somebody rushed the base.
We are not the cheapest quote you will get. What you are buying is a base built properly under the part you can see.

What we build
Three kinds of work, done properly
Patios & Walkways
Flagstone, travertine and shell stone, set on a compacted base with polymeric joints that hold up to summer storms.
Retaining Walls
Segmental and dry stacked walls with proper drainage behind them, which is the part that decides whether a wall lasts.
Outdoor Living Spaces
Seating walls, fire pits, outdoor kitchen bases and pool decks, built as one piece of work rather than four visits.
Why us
What we do differently
The base, not the surface
Six inches of compacted crushed concrete under a patio, eight under a driveway. It costs more and it is the reason our work does not move.
Drainage first
In Florida the water decides everything. We work out where it goes before we choose a stone, and we will tell you if your grade needs fixing first.
We finish before we start the next one
One job at a time per crew. No half built patio waiting three weeks while everyone is somewhere else.
